Parish Grounds and Madonna Grotto Vandalised
A stone grotto was demolished, statues of the Madonna and Padre Pio were desecrated, and church gardens were destroyed in a targeted act of vandalism at the Church of San Francesco in Francofonte.
In Francofonte, Italy, unidentified individuals vandalised the Church of San Francesco and its surrounding grounds during the night. The perpetrators demolished a stone grotto containing a statue of the Madonna, which was forcibly removed and thrown to the ground.
